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6552024 1788162 303423510 80
9219615484 741 614346
9219615484 741 614346
26486 1301512 699682 86114
All about undefined
Interested in learning more?
9219615484 741 614346
26486 1301512 699682 86114
See more
26 259701139 95997076
33352 5216881778 51
See more
67286587132 307950 4100372041
25040 956 7759393465 478719524
See more